From testing [level 28 char, RIP :( ]

Quests - work the same, you just don't get any XP from them. i.e. you get all items / rewards. I don't know anything about Maeonir, but I presume you can still do the stones quests to get over there.

No buying from merchants, barring spell trainers

University - not tested (too poor!) but I assume you can train skills

Catherine wrote:I've not seen a miner's pick or pen knife drop yet - I know pen knives do, however, as well as axes, but I've a sneaky suspicion that you won't be able to get ore for tints. Then you face the issue that if you break a tool, you're royally buggered until you find another one!
Well, I've just found 2 hammers, 1 pocket knife and 1 pick... but that was from about an hours worth of grinding dragons on reg. Might be different on PD. Wouldn't hurt increasing the drop rate though. Not sure about the tint question, but you don't actually need tinted ore or ingots to make tinted pocket knives. (weird, I know).

Personally I think pocket knives should be moved from Weapon smithing to the tinkering skill set. You can't use them as a weapon so...

Tool breakage would be an issue until you can make your own tools with tinkering (I think hammers, pocket knives, and just recently I think mining pick are craftable as well.) You wouldn't need much skill - 10% tink for mining pick, 30% tink for smithing hammers. The only tools tinkering can't make is more tinker kits. :(

Important LOTL change/clarifcation/bug fix:

LOTL chars are not meant to be able to pick up other lotl's stuff, even when in a party. This was a bug, it's getting fixed right now.

not changed but aware of and probably won't change:
LOTL chars can party and share xp
LOTL chars can get buffed
LOTL chars can have their stuff uncursed and id'd by priests
LOTL chars can receieve heimlich's
